Understanding Casting Announcements
Dancing with the Stars usually announces its cast in staggered waves, with celebrities revealed first, followed by professionals. Reliable timelines include press releases, talk show appearances, and social media confirmations. Outlets that report casting changes typically cite contract documents or official scheduling notices. Because announcements can shift due to production logistics, treat unofficial lists as speculative until corroborated by primary sources.
